  • Corruption Allegations Against Nabam Tuki: Public Interest Litigation under Prevention of Corruption Act, 1988 (Sections 13(1)(d)(i),(ii),(iii)). Contracts awarded to relatives like Nabam Tagam (brother) for District Sports Complex (Rs. 2,03,83,300) and M/s. Assam Arunachal Agency without norms, via MOU dated 25.1.2005. Also, low-cost housing to wife Nabam Yani's agency lacking licenses. Court directed CBI probe, FIR at Guwahati Special Court. 2015 0 Supreme(Gau) 1319 2015 0 Supreme(Gau) 676

    Sri Nabam Tagam is the younger brother of Sri Nabam Tuki hon'ble Minister (PWD & UD) and the said contract was awarded... at the behest of said Minister. 2015 0 Supreme(Gau) 1319
